You could open a Fidelity account and link it to your main bank account, and deposit into one of their money market accounts. It will pay better interest, because its basically a government backed security.
It's the default fund when you open the account and fund it. You can transfer back and forth, although not is fast as if the money is in the same bank as your bank account. I think mine does next business day.
I actually direct deposit a little into my account every pay day, and then invest it in some mutual funds. It helps when the market is up, not so much when its down, but the MMA earns interest every month. FIDELITY all day. There MM paid a little less than US T-Bills last year. We use Fidelity to move money in and out of 4 week T-Bills to avoid paying any state income tax.
